From: Sergey Matveev Date: Mon, 14 Jul 2025 12:32:05 +0000 (+0300) Subject: Update Go 1.24 X-Git-Url: http://www.git.cypherpunks.su/?a=commitdiff_plain;h=0fdf2c5f83363adf7e79f271c3c39a6a3e6297a5db79492cea1f4adbeb873479;p=bass.git Update Go 1.24 --- diff --git a/build/distfiles/.gitignore b/build/distfiles/.gitignore index baa062c..2d04b69 100644 --- a/build/distfiles/.gitignore +++ b/build/distfiles/.gitignore @@ -72,7 +72,7 @@ /go1.17.13.tar.gz /go1.20.14.tar.gz /go1.23.5.tar.gz -/go1.24.0.tar.gz +/go1.24.5.tar.gz /go1.4.3.tar.gz /gocheese-4.2.0.tar.zst /gogost-6.1.0.tar.zst @@ -81,7 +81,7 @@ /gomodcache/ /goredo-2.6.4.tar.zst /gosha3-v1.0.0-modcache -/gostls13-1.24.0.patch.zst +/gostls13-1.24.5.patch.zst /gostls13.git/ /gpgme-1.23.2.tar.bz2 /graphviz-11.0.0.tar.xz diff --git a/build/distfiles/go1.24.0.tar.gz.meta4 b/build/distfiles/go1.24.0.tar.gz.meta4 deleted file mode 100644 index b098399..0000000 --- a/build/distfiles/go1.24.0.tar.gz.meta4 +++ /dev/null @@ -1,16 +0,0 @@ - - - - 361aeb0f8d831325c8479102646b9b5845cd723449fa7999b8cbcb12f5830b11 - 1a74d268ad2bcfd4773eb9d24f0618491680a5347edba60606b3f50144e2d8879509b2640046e5fa535ff126958deb49c4224443210e3bd79523e65208b616e3 - 330ab0fa33f87ca0e5b1793c9522d8b995215795388b3759344e1ec1ab079a1f - b19e33d7deaab7e33f5118cbb976d41b088c964c37407cb33c7292d77a9c6c81f739a26806e904ae9fbc2f3e512507417487ef6325727bdc6e85b73c477a6904 - 36ba9a3a541208fd33aa49b969d892578e209570541d2b6ca6ff784250d8b6777597d347b823c6026acf0c2741b4abc9012693004e623a1434b06cfecdbebaa8 - d14120614acb29d12bcab72bd689f257eb4be9e0b6f88a8fb7e41ac65f8556e5 - c02372ae90f11727dd80a375b58d6c250137392db0b53a0bfddc4bf771e31f51cb4d15223a155773a848d893076277dd2d2b27fa1d286838134fd3ae8ff6e619 - b48ff9e7601dae6d308ca31527d7e35fc9927dcf791e280a8192af5f86af5348 - d83de33573a662ffea8b0e2306df82a5 - 30663922 - https://go.dev/dl/go1.24.0.src.tar.gz - - diff --git a/build/distfiles/go1.24.5.tar.gz.meta4 b/build/distfiles/go1.24.5.tar.gz.meta4 new file mode 100644 index 0000000..e2fc3ed --- /dev/null +++ b/build/distfiles/go1.24.5.tar.gz.meta4 @@ -0,0 +1,16 @@ + + + + acf47c9541f53e32847d9570a8802c1f49619403e879a170b76086937e4155f2 + 47d281c221ca87f7b668e5e44017b77c408c08543ded64c54de9515cd3759f92228983f878e39ae0d52e7bbdae4c09161381196bb7efb48e77f38694195c883e + 3fce1520129cb72df5569eee58b60499a81a29b528a4922552838e8a518d3419 + e8aab5c902508151117210827d57a26045a318618eb55ce0d93f4529a82c373780be9a7d789e4c7f3bf5a39ed42aed809fbfbeafe16795d83d9b6d5a8362bf6d + 917cd6ac83e3370227da40f8490697e8638847e9279ed1806044a173d3b52829c67c429990db92d8aadcfba6a37bfc00114c1ecec3ac387a781bb7edc8dcab22 + 74fdb09f2352e2b25b7943e56836c9b47363d28dec1c8b56c4a9570f30b8f59f + a8e861aa9ac1e4aa1fed1ce5a010b6937dccd5ed555408b637c659f46b5c22a3afba616923b8efdc92dcaa8a25c20dae6b0bbce9b8b7e3a808c375e090d28125 + ef22264ac778f3caf4269f1bde69506b20d1de366d0f115733cf4dc50ee00d35 + 6f1c0f25e69b885ca345a4c7ee8fa96e + 30792943 + https://go.dev/dl/go1.24.5.src.tar.gz + + diff --git a/build/distfiles/gostls13-1.24.0.patch.zst.do b/build/distfiles/gostls13-1.24.5.patch.zst.do similarity index 96% rename from build/distfiles/gostls13-1.24.0.patch.zst.do rename to build/distfiles/gostls13-1.24.5.patch.zst.do index 894457d..f650e5e 100644 --- a/build/distfiles/gostls13-1.24.0.patch.zst.do +++ b/build/distfiles/gostls13-1.24.5.patch.zst.do @@ -2,7 +2,7 @@ sname=$1.do . "$BASS_ROOT"/lib/rc [ -d gostls13.git ] || git clone --depth 1 --bare git://git.cypherpunks.su/gostls13.git >&2 cd gostls13.git -tag=go1.24.0-gost +tag=go1.24.5-gost git fetch origin tag $tag ${tag%-gost} >&2 echo gostls13@cypherpunks.su ssh-ed25519 AAAAC3NzaC1lZDI1NTE5AAAAILuX3gTqrFb3G2oW/osn3LIa7X5spo0MTsEIRLKVfJrq >allowed-signers git config gpg.ssh.allowedSignersFile "$(realpath allowed-signers)" diff --git a/build/skel/devel/go-stringer-0.18.0.do b/build/skel/devel/go-stringer-0.18.0.do index 69db519..7eb92b1 100644 --- a/build/skel/devel/go-stringer-0.18.0.do +++ b/build/skel/devel/go-stringer-0.18.0.do @@ -2,7 +2,7 @@ sname=$1.do . "$BASS_ROOT"/lib/rc . "$BASS_ROOT"/build/skel/common.rc -bdeps="rc-paths stow archivers/zstd lang/go1.24.0" +bdeps="rc-paths stow archivers/zstd lang/go1.24.5" redo-ifchange $bdeps "$DISTFILES"/golang.org-x-tools-0.18.0-modcache hsh=$("$BASS_ROOT"/build/bin/cksum $BASS_REV $SPATH) . "$BASS_ROOT"/build/lib/create-tmp-for-build.rc diff --git a/build/skel/devel/goredo-2.6.4.do b/build/skel/devel/goredo-2.6.4.do index c016ee4..8aae05a 100644 --- a/build/skel/devel/goredo-2.6.4.do +++ b/build/skel/devel/goredo-2.6.4.do @@ -2,7 +2,7 @@ sname=$1.do . "$BASS_ROOT"/lib/rc . "$BASS_ROOT"/build/skel/common.rc -bdeps="rc-paths stow archivers/zstd lang/go1.24.0" +bdeps="rc-paths stow archivers/zstd lang/go1.24.5" redo-ifchange $bdeps "$DISTFILES"/$NAME.tar.zst hsh=$("$BASS_ROOT"/build/bin/cksum $BASS_REV $SPATH) . "$BASS_ROOT"/build/lib/create-tmp-for-build.rc diff --git a/build/skel/lang/go1.24.0.do b/build/skel/lang/go1.24.5.do similarity index 93% rename from build/skel/lang/go1.24.0.do rename to build/skel/lang/go1.24.5.do index cc1054c..214cc45 100644 --- a/build/skel/lang/go1.24.0.do +++ b/build/skel/lang/go1.24.5.do @@ -8,7 +8,7 @@ goprev=go1.23.5 redo-ifchange $bdeps "$DISTFILES"/$NAME.tar.gz lang/$goprev [ -z "$GOSTLS13_ENABLED" ] || redo-ifchange \ - "$DISTFILES"/gostls13-1.24.0.patch.zst \ + "$DISTFILES"/gostls13-1.24.5.patch.zst \ "$DISTFILES"/gogost-6.1.0.tar.zst hsh=$("$BASS_ROOT"/build/bin/cksum $BASS_REV $SPATH) @@ -21,7 +21,7 @@ $TAR xf "$DISTFILES"/$NAME.tar.gz cd go if [ -n "$GOSTLS13_ENABLED" ] ; then - zstd -d <"$DISTFILES"/gostls13-1.24.0.patch.zst | patch >&2 + zstd -d <"$DISTFILES"/gostls13-1.24.5.patch.zst | patch >&2 cp "$DISTFILES"/gogost-6.1.0.tar.zst . chmod +x debash gogost-install ./gogost-install >&2 diff --git a/build/skel/misc/gocheese-4.2.0.do b/build/skel/misc/gocheese-4.2.0.do index 7014441..5b1bd93 100644 --- a/build/skel/misc/gocheese-4.2.0.do +++ b/build/skel/misc/gocheese-4.2.0.do @@ -2,7 +2,7 @@ sname=$1.do . "$BASS_ROOT"/lib/rc . "$BASS_ROOT"/build/skel/common.rc -bdeps="rc-paths stow archivers/zstd lang/go1.24.0" +bdeps="rc-paths stow archivers/zstd lang/go1.24.5" redo-ifchange $bdeps "$DISTFILES"/$NAME.tar.zst hsh=$("$BASS_ROOT"/build/bin/cksum $BASS_REV $SPATH) . "$BASS_ROOT"/build/lib/create-tmp-for-build.rc diff --git a/build/skel/security/age-v1.1.1-23-g29b68c2.do b/build/skel/security/age-v1.1.1-23-g29b68c2.do index f030594..2fcbe73 100644 --- a/build/skel/security/age-v1.1.1-23-g29b68c2.do +++ b/build/skel/security/age-v1.1.1-23-g29b68c2.do @@ -2,7 +2,7 @@ sname=$1.do . "$BASS_ROOT"/lib/rc . "$BASS_ROOT"/build/skel/common.rc -bdeps="rc-paths stow archivers/zstd lang/go1.24.0" +bdeps="rc-paths stow archivers/zstd lang/go1.24.5" redo-ifchange $bdeps "$DISTFILES"/$NAME.tar.zst "$DISTFILES"/$NAME-modcache hsh=$("$BASS_ROOT"/build/bin/cksum $BASS_REV $SPATH) . "$BASS_ROOT"/build/lib/create-tmp-for-build.rc diff --git a/build/skel/security/gosha3-v1.0.0.do b/build/skel/security/gosha3-v1.0.0.do index 92091e9..75f2881 100644 --- a/build/skel/security/gosha3-v1.0.0.do +++ b/build/skel/security/gosha3-v1.0.0.do @@ -2,7 +2,7 @@ sname=$1.do . "$BASS_ROOT"/lib/rc . "$BASS_ROOT"/build/skel/common.rc -bdeps="rc-paths stow archivers/zstd lang/go1.24.0" +bdeps="rc-paths stow archivers/zstd lang/go1.24.5" redo-ifchange $bdeps "$DISTFILES"/$NAME-modcache hsh=$("$BASS_ROOT"/build/bin/cksum $BASS_REV $SPATH) . "$BASS_ROOT"/build/lib/create-tmp-for-build.rc diff --git a/build/skel/sysutils/meta4ra-0.11.0.do b/build/skel/sysutils/meta4ra-0.11.0.do index 3fc3909..815eed4 100644 --- a/build/skel/sysutils/meta4ra-0.11.0.do +++ b/build/skel/sysutils/meta4ra-0.11.0.do @@ -2,7 +2,7 @@ sname=$1.do . "$BASS_ROOT"/lib/rc . "$BASS_ROOT"/build/skel/common.rc -bdeps="rc-paths stow archivers/zstd lang/go1.24.0" +bdeps="rc-paths stow archivers/zstd lang/go1.24.5" redo-ifchange $bdeps "$DISTFILES"/$NAME.tar.zst hsh=$("$BASS_ROOT"/build/bin/cksum $BASS_REV $SPATH) . "$BASS_ROOT"/build/lib/create-tmp-for-build.rc diff --git a/build/skel/textproc/fzf-0.53.0.do b/build/skel/textproc/fzf-0.53.0.do index 50c6667..6dd82bc 100644 --- a/build/skel/textproc/fzf-0.53.0.do +++ b/build/skel/textproc/fzf-0.53.0.do @@ -2,7 +2,7 @@ sname=$1.do . "$BASS_ROOT"/lib/rc . "$BASS_ROOT"/build/skel/common.rc -bdeps="rc-paths stow archivers/zstd lang/go1.24.0" +bdeps="rc-paths stow archivers/zstd lang/go1.24.5" redo-ifchange $bdeps "$DISTFILES"/$NAME-modcache hsh=$("$BASS_ROOT"/build/bin/cksum $BASS_REV $SPATH) . "$BASS_ROOT"/build/lib/create-tmp-for-build.rc diff --git a/contrib/prepare-deps/steps/050-go1.24.0.dl b/contrib/prepare-deps/steps/050-go1.24.0.dl deleted file mode 100644 index 151007b..0000000 --- a/contrib/prepare-deps/steps/050-go1.24.0.dl +++ /dev/null @@ -1 +0,0 @@ -dodl https://go.dev/dl/$name.src.tar.gz $name.src.tar.gz 36ba9a3a541208fd33aa49b969d892578e209570541d2b6ca6ff784250d8b6777597d347b823c6026acf0c2741b4abc9012693004e623a1434b06cfecdbebaa8 diff --git a/contrib/prepare-deps/steps/050-go1.24.0 b/contrib/prepare-deps/steps/050-go1.24.5 similarity index 100% rename from contrib/prepare-deps/steps/050-go1.24.0 rename to contrib/prepare-deps/steps/050-go1.24.5 diff --git a/contrib/prepare-deps/steps/050-go1.24.5.dl b/contrib/prepare-deps/steps/050-go1.24.5.dl new file mode 100644 index 0000000..8bf969e --- /dev/null +++ b/contrib/prepare-deps/steps/050-go1.24.5.dl @@ -0,0 +1 @@ +dodl https://go.dev/dl/$name.src.tar.gz $name.src.tar.gz 917cd6ac83e3370227da40f8490697e8638847e9279ed1806044a173d3b52829c67c429990db92d8aadcfba6a37bfc00114c1ecec3ac387a781bb7edc8dcab22